air compressors are mechanical devices that convert power into potential energy stored in pressurized air. This pressurized air is then used to power various tools and equipment through a hose. The key component of an air compressor is the compressor pump, which works by drawing in air and compressing it to increase its pressure. This compressed air is stored in a tank until it is needed, at which point it is released through a hose attached to the tool or equipment being powered.

There are several types of air compressors available on the market, each with its own unique features and advantages. The most common types include:

1. Reciprocating Air Compressors: These are the most traditional type of air compressor and work by using a piston-driven system to compress air. Reciprocating air compressors are typically used for light to medium-duty tasks and are available in both portable and stationary models.

2. Rotary Screw Air Compressors: These air compressors use two screws rotating in opposite directions to compress air. They are known for their high efficiency and are often used in heavy-duty industrial applications that require continuous and consistent power.

3. Centrifugal Air Compressors: These air compressors work by using a high-speed rotating impeller to accelerate air, which is then compressed in a diffuser. Centrifugal air compressors are ideal for large-scale industrial applications that require high volumes of compressed air.

4. Scroll Air Compressors: These air compressors use two spiral-shaped scrolls to compress air. They are known for their quiet operation and are commonly used in applications that require clean and oil-free compressed air, such as medical and laboratory settings.

When choosing an air compressor, there are several factors to consider to ensure you get the right one for your needs. These factors include:

– CFM (Cubic Feet per Minute) Rating: This indicates the amount of air that the compressor can deliver in a minute and is an important factor to consider when choosing an air compressor for a specific task.
– Tank Size: The tank size determines how much compressed air the compressor can store, which can affect its performance and efficiency.
– Horsepower (HP) Rating: This indicates the power output of the compressor and is an important factor to consider when choosing an air compressor for heavy-duty tasks.

In addition to these factors, it is also important to consider the portability, noise level, and maintenance requirements of the air compressor.
